Voting was held on 25 May 2024 in the 3rd phase of the Odisha Assembly Election &amp;amp; 6th phase of the Indian General Election. The counting of votes was on 4 June 2024.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|title=General Election to Legislative Assembly of Odisha 2024 |url=https://elections24.eci.gov.in/election-details-odisa.html |website=[[Election Commission of India|ECI]]}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; In 2024 election, [[Bharatiya Janata Party]] candidate [[Rabi Narayan Naik]] defeated [[Biju Janata Dal]] candidate Rajendra Kumar Chhatria by a margin of 32,220 votes.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;:2&amp;quot; /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

In the 2019 election, [[Biju Janata Dal]] candidate [[Kishore Chandra Naik]] defeated [[Bharatiya Janata Party]] candidate [[Rabi Narayan Naik]] by a margin of 3,508 votes.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;Odisha Assembly election results 2019: Full list of winners&amp;quot;&amp;gt;{{cite news |last1=Zee News |date=24 May 2019 |title=Odisha Assembly election results 2019: Full list of winners |url=https://zeenews.india.com/assembly-elections/odisha-assembly-election-results-2019-full-list-of-winners-2205899.html |archiveurl=https://web.archive.org/web/20221108183944/https://zeenews.india.com/assembly-elections/odisha-assembly-election-results-2019-full-list-of-winners-2205899.html |archivedate=8 November 2022 |accessdate=8 November 2022 |language=en}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;:1&amp;quot; /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

In 2014 election, [[Bharatiya Janata Party]] candidate [[Rabi Narayan Naik]] defeated [[Biju Janata Dal]] candidate Bhubaneswar Kisan by a margin of 22,064 votes.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;:3&amp;quot;&amp;gt;{{cite web|title=Constituency Wise odisha Assembly Election result 2014|url=http://leadtech.in/infoelection/index.php/odisha/2604-constituency-wise-odisha-assembly-election-result.html|publisher=Leadtech.in|accessdate=15 June 2014|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20140818230907/http://leadtech.in/infoelection/index.php/odisha/2604-constituency-wise-odisha-assembly-election-result.html|archive-date=18 August 2014|url-status=dead}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;:0&amp;quot; /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

In 2009 election, [[Indian National Congress]] candidate Rajendra Kumar Chhatria defeated [[Bharatiya Janata Party]] candidate [[Rabi Narayan Naik]] by a margin of 12,712 votes.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;:4&amp;quot;&amp;gt;{{cite web |url=http://leadtech.in/infoelection/index.php/odisha/431-odisha-election-result-2009-votemargin.html |title=Orissa Election Result 2009 With Vote Margin |work=leadtech.in |quote=12712 |accessdate=5 January 2014 |arch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20130527163949/http://leadtech.in/infoelection/index.php/odisha/431-odisha-election-result-2009-votemargin.html |archive-date=27 May 2013 |url-status=dead }}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
